我正在尝试运行Keycloak 3.2.1.Final后面的nginx反向代理(后来这将成为Ingress)。目标是从不同的地址到达相同的keycloak服务,如下:
等等。
我设法做的是从' auth '更改standalone.xml
<web-context>
设置。到&#39; foo1 / baz1 / keycloak &#39;并达到这样的服务:
但是在没有配置的组合中我能够通过端口80上的a.com域来使Nginx代理和Keycloak服务器协同工作。
有一个非常相似的问题@ Configure reverse-proxy for Keycloak docker with custom base URL
的解决方案但是这似乎不起作用了(不再?)。
Ty你的时间。
答案 0 :(得分:0)
在这里查看我的答案:https://stackoverflow.com/a/54311713/2117355
在最新版本的Keycloak中,您还需要修改standalone-ha.xml
。